Glenn Diesen - Greater Eurasia Podcast explores how Russian foreign policy, geoeconomics, and Eurasian integration are reshaping the world order. Hosted by Professor Glenn Diesen, this podcast offers in depth discussions on the shifting balance of power between East and West, the rise of Greater Eurasia as a strategic and economic space, and the ideas driving these transformations. Listeners can expect thoughtful analysis, accessible explanations of complex geopolitical trends, and conversations that connect current events to long term structural changes in international politics. Whether you follow news and politics closely or are just beginning to explore global affairs, you can listen episodes to gain a clearer understanding of why Eurasia matters and how it influences security, trade, and diplomacy. This podcast is for anyone seeking serious, informed perspectives beyond the usual headlines.
